The present invention relates to a process for cleaning a crude mixture comprising dinitrotoluene, nitric acid, nitrogen oxides and sulfuric acid obtained by nitration of toluene after separation of the nitric acid, comprising two cleaning steps (WS-I) and (WS- II), wherein i) In a first rinse step (WS-I), the crude mixture is extracted with cleansing acid I comprising nitric acid, nitrogen oxides and sulfuric acid by a cleansing comprising at least one extraction step, wherein the first cleansing step (WS- The cleaning acid discharged from the first extraction stage (WS-I-1) of the present invention has a total acid content of 20 to 40% by weight, obtaining a premilled cleaned crude mixture, ii) In a second cleaning step (WS-II), the pre-cleaned crude mixture comprising dinitrotoluene is extracted with cleansing acid II in a wash comprising at least one extraction stage, wherein the second cleansing step (WS- (WS-II-1) of the present invention has a pH of 4 or less, and a mixture comprising dinitrotoluene substantially free of nitric acid, sulfuric acid and nitrogen oxides is obtained . |
